Building Resilience Skills for children in Tower Hamlets and Hackney

We are delighted to be offering schools and organisations in Tower Hamlets and Hackney our brand new programme SPARK Resilience thanks to funding from Allen & Overy. Their funding will enable us to provide resources, training and support sessions for up to 35 schools and organisations in Tower Hamlets and Hackney to help them build resilience skills in the children and young people they work with.

SPARK Resilience uses mindfulness, positive psychology and c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) to give children skills to boost their strengths, control strong emotions and reframe habitual ways of thinking. Evaluations found that SPARK Resilience was effective in boosting resilience and preventing depression.

The impact of this work will be that 2000 children have increased resilience and coping skills, helping them to make a successful transition from primary to secondary education. They will be able to better cope with change, navigate new friendship groups, and reach out for help if they need advice or support. Our programmes have been developed to ensure that they benefit particularly vulnerable children in classrooms – such as looked after children and young carers.

All of these skills will also benefit children as they transition into the worlds of further education and employment.
